S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The Department of Health and Human Services
published an interim final rule in the Federal Register on January 6,
2012 (77 FR 950), effective on February 6, 2012, that revised
regulations for the title IV-E program to implement statutory
provisions related to the tribal title IV-E program (see section 479B
of the Social Security Act (the Act) that authorizes direct federal
funding of Indian tribes, tribal organizations, and tribal consortia
that choose to operate a foster care, adoption assistance and, at
tribal option, a kinship guardianship assistance program under title
IV-E of the Act). The interim final rule inadvertently included
incorrect numbering of one paragraph in 45 CFR 1356.60(a) regarding
requirements for Federal matching funds for title IV-E foster care
maintenance and adoption assistance payments. This document corrects
the regulations by revising this section.

2. Amend Sec. 1356.60 by revising paragraph (a) to read as follows:
Sec. 1356.60 Fiscal requirements (title IV-E).
(a) Federal matching funds for foster care maintenance and adoption
assistance payments. (1) Federal financial participation (FFP) is
available to title IV-E agencies under an approved title IV-E plan for
allowable costs in expenditures for:
(i) Foster care maintenance payments as defined in section 475(4)
of the Act, made in accordance with Sec. Sec. 1356.20 through 1356.30,
section 472 of the Act, and, for a Tribal title IV-E agency, section
479B of the Act; and
(ii) Adoption assistance payments made in accordance with
Sec. Sec. 1356.20 and 1356.40, applicable provisions of section 473,
section 475(3), and, for a Tribal title IV-E agency, section 479B of
the Act.
(2) Federal financial participation is available at the rate of the
Federal medical assistance percentage as defined in section 1905(b),
474(a)(1) and (2), and 479B(d) of the Act as applicable, definitions,
and pertinent regulations as promulgated by the Secretary, or the
designee.
